C# 使用Confluent.Kafka连接 Kafka 报错 local value deserialization error
时间: 2024-01-24 19:20:39 浏览: 157
Confluent.Kafka源代码_测试.rar
这个错误通常出现在消费者代码中,当消费者从 Kafka 主题中读取消息并尝试反序列化消息时发生问题。这可能是因为消息的格式与消费者代码中使用的反序列化器不兼容。
要解决这个问题,有几种可能的解决方案:
1. 确认消息的格式与消费者代码中使用的反序列化器兼容。如果不兼容,可以更改消费者代码或更改消息格式。
2. 确认 Kafka 主题中的消息格式是否正确。如果不正确,可以更改生产者代码或更改 Kafka 主题配置。
3. 确认消费者代码中使用的反序列化器是否正确配置。如果不正确,可以尝试更改配置以匹配消息格式。
4. 确认 Kafka 集群的版本是否与消费者代码中使用的 Kafka 客户端版本兼容。如果不兼容,可以尝试升级或降级 Kafka 客户端版本以匹配 Kafka 集群版本。
如果以上解决方案无法解决问题,可以检查消费者代码中的其他问题或查看 Kafka 客户端日志以获取更多信息。
阅读全文